GTA 6 Heartbreak: Highly Anticipated Release Pushed to Late 2026!

Grand Theft Auto 6, the highly anticipated next installment in the iconic series, has unfortunately faced further delays, pushing its release date to November 19, 2026. This announcement from developer Rockstar Games marks another shift from its initial target of a 2025 release, which was subsequently adjusted to May 26, 2026. The prolonged wait for GTA 6 is particularly notable given the significant gap since the last main entry, Grand Theft Auto V, which launched in September 2013. This 13-year hiatus represents the longest interval between releases in the franchise's history, intensifying fan anticipation.
The upcoming title promises an immersive experience set in the fictional state of Leonida. Within this expansive world, players will recognize and return to the beloved titular metropolis of Vice City, a location famously featured in 2002's Grand Theft Auto: Vice City. A key innovation in GTA 6 will allow players to control two distinct protagonists: the criminal duo of Jason Duval and Lucia Caminos, as they navigate their adventures across Leonida.
The immense success of its predecessor further underscores the high expectations for GTA 6. As of 2025, Grand Theft Auto V holds the impressive distinction of being the second-highest-selling video game of all time. Publisher Take-Two Interactive has reported staggering sales figures, with the game having moved an astounding 220 million units globally. This historical performance sets a high bar for the new release, despite the extended development period and multiple delays.
